Episode 43: Eric Starr (Arkham Tattoo/guitarist, D.I.M.) Part 2 “I’m definitely house broken.”

Eric Starr is the former guitarist of hardcore-punk band D.I.M and the owner of Arkham Tattoo, located in Akron. I’ve known Eric for a really, really long time now and always enjoy hanging out with him. We cover a ton of ground – partly because we don’t get to see each other much – partly […]